Football Recap: Fairview Tigers vs. Oil City Oilers
Something's probably wrong if your team accumulates more yards in penalties than offense, a fact Fairview just learned the hard way. They were dealt a 56-0 defeat at the hands of the Oil City Oilers on Friday. The game marked the first time this season in which the Tigers were not able to get on the board.
Oil City was led to victory by Steven Heise and Spence Singleton. Heise rushed for 130 yards and one touchdown, while Singleton picked up 40 receiving yards and one TD. Those 40 receiving yards gave Singleton a new career-high.
Fairview is on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-4. As for Oil City,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 4-1.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Fairview will head out to square off against Seneca at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Oil City, they will venture away from home to take on Grove City at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. That match will pit two of the most dominant backs against one another: Heise and Gavin Purdy.
